The funny and tender story of Maisie who lives with her parents in the Gone Bonkers Discount Palace. She shares her troubles and joys with her invisible friend, Lucy, and longs for her father who is often away driving his truck.;;From the creator of Brian Banana Duck Sunshine Yellow.

Chris McKimmie is a writer, illustrator, artist. His latest book was Brian Banana Duck Sunshine Yellow published in 2005 by Allen + Unwin. Chris was for many years the convenor and originator of the illustration program at the Queensland College of Art, Griffith University. He wrote, illustrated and designed a series of 8 children's books in the 70s, and has designed many covers for the University of Queensland Press. Represented in the Graphis Annual, he has worked as a graphic designer and publications designer for the ABC, the National Parks and Wildlife Services and the University of WA Press. He was production designer for the award-winning short film Stations and the feature-length film Australian Dream, and wrote the lyrics for the songs in both films. He regularly exhibits his paintings and drawings.
